Talent.com
No longer accepting applications
DevOps Engineer

DevOps Engineer

OMEGA SystemsBurnaby, BC, Canada
17 days ago
Job type
  • Full-time
Job description

Role Summary :

As a Senior Infrastructure Engineer at OMEGA, you’ll be instrumental in designing, implementing, and managing our infrastructure, both cloud-based and on-premises. A key focus of the role will be on monitoring, security, database administration, and event-driven technologies like Kafka, which are central to our application architecture. This position offers an exciting opportunity for a highly skilled engineer to impact an innovative, dynamic industry.

Key Responsibilities :

  • Infrastructure Monitoring & Performance Optimization :  Design and maintain end-to-end monitoring solutions (e.g., Prometheus, Grafana, CloudWatch) for high system performance and quick response to incidents.
  • SQL Server Administration :  Manage SQL Server environments, ensuring high availability, optimized performance, security compliance, and reliable backup / recovery strategies.
  • Event-Driven Architecture Management :  Set up, configure, and manage Kafka clusters for real-time data processing and event streaming across the application. Ensure high availability, scalability, and fault tolerance of the Kafka infrastructure.
  • Redis Management :  Oversee and optimize Redis deployments as a high-performance caching and data store layer within the application architecture.
  • Cloudflare Security & Cloud Security :  Implement and manage security protocols, including Cloudflare configurations (DDoS protection, WAF, rate limiting) and AWS security services for resilient, secure infrastructure.
  • Networking & Cloud Management :  Configure and troubleshoot network architectures, including VPNs, VPCs, and load balancing in AWS to secure connections and optimize performance.
  • Automation & IaC :  Develop Infrastructure as Code (IaC) scripts with Terraform, CloudFormation, or Ansible to automate deployments, enforce consistency, and maintain scalability.
  • Incident Response & Troubleshooting :  Act as the lead for incident response, working through root cause analysis to ensure continuous improvement and stability.
  • Cross-Functional Collaboration :  Partner with security, database, and DevOps teams to streamline workflows and mentor junior engineers.

Required Qualifications :

  • Experience :  7+ years in infrastructure engineering or a related field.
  • Event-Driven Technologies :  Proven expertise in setting up, managing, and troubleshooting Kafka clusters, with a strong understanding of event-driven architecture.
  • Redis Experience :  Hands-on experience with Redis for caching and data storage optimization.
  • Monitoring Expertise :  Advanced experience with monitoring and alerting tools (Prometheus, Grafana, CloudWatch) for real-time performance insights and incident management.
  • SQL Server Administration :  Extensive knowledge of SQL Server, including performance tuning, high-availability setups, backup / recovery, and security management.
  • Security Focus :  Strong experience with Cloudflare and AWS security solutions, focusing on protection, compliance, and secure infrastructure.
  • Network & Cloud Management :  Deep understanding of networking protocols, VPC setup, VPN, DNS, and AWS resource management.
  • Automation & IaC Skills :  Proficient in Terraform, CloudFormation, or Ansible for consistent and automated infrastructure provisioning.
  • Preferred Qualifications :

  • Relevant certifications such as AWS Certified Solutions Architect, or SQL Server Database certifications.
  • Knowledge of containerized environments (Docker, Kubernetes) and orchestration platforms.
  • Familiarity with CI / CD tools like Jenkins, GitLab CI, or similar.
  • Why Join OMEGA?

  • Competitive salary and benefits package
  • Exciting growth opportunities in a fast-paced, global industry
  • Collaborative, innovative team environment with remote flexibility
  • Opportunity to work on impactful projects supporting online gaming and sports betting platforms
  • If you’re skilled in monitoring, event-driven technologies, security, and database administration and ready to make a difference, we’d love to hear from you! Join our team at OMEGA and help shape the future of our clients’ infrastructure.